#eb5278 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b5278 is composed of 92.2% red, 32.2%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 345.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#eb5278 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4f0 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#eb5278 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b5278 has RGB values of R:235, G:82,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.49,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15422072.

Shades and Tints of #eb5278
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fdf0f3 is the lightest one.
